What is the average cost of auto insurance in Ohio?

Auto insurance is typically inexpensive in Ohio. The average auto insurance price in Ohio is $1,037 per year — 27.3% less than the national average. But auto insurance premiums are affected by factors other than the state in which you live.

Who has the cheapest car insurance in Ohio for a speeding ticket?

Erie and State Farm increase Ohio driver insurance costs the least on average for a speeding ticket, but Geico overall is the cheapest car insurance for drivers with a speeding ticket. Insurers in Ohio charge drivers with an at-fault accident that caused an injury $1,700 more on average compared to drivers with a clean record.
